Subject: Intern cohort arriving Monday

Hello all,

The Brightvale summer intern cohort arrives Monday at 9:00. They will gather in the Larkspur Lobby before orientation in Room 2B. New starters escorting interns should sign them in at the front desk first. To open the orientation wing door, use the temporary pass code below.

door code, fawip-yagef: bdg-NPIWQ-43434

Subject: Quickstore 4.2 — bloom filter now fronts the KV layer

Plugin authors: starting with this release, Quickstore places a bloom filter ahead of the key-value store. Negative lookups return faster; false positives fall through safely. No API changes are required on your side. Verify your plugin against the staging build referenced below.

session token of fahif-tadup = htk3_9c7

Reworks the locker access flow for the Sudsport laundry kiosks. Previously a failed badge scan held the latch open for the full grace window, which let follow-on users grab the wrong bin. Now we close immediately on reject, debounce re-scans, and log each latch event to the Brimhall audit stream. No schema changes. If lockers start sticking after deploy, roll back the latch timings first. Current tuning values follow.

constants for fajop-tahaf:
RATE_LIMITS = {
    "holael": 2,
    "oliael": 10,
    "druael": 10,
    "wenwyn": 10,
}

## Payment retries — idempotency keys

Quick recap for the sync: the Tollbridge gateway now requires an idempotency key on every retry, so double-charges from flaky networks are finally dead. Retries reuse the original key; new attempts mint a fresh one. Don't hand-roll keys in scripts — the client lib does it. One catch: the retry worker's release artifact has to be signed before the scheduler will pick it up, so use the key below.

release key, hahop-fajef: bky6_G6gfvh